MAINTENANCE SUMMARY

The 2015 Jeep Cherokee demands diligent maintenance, particularly concerning its power liftgate module, which is prone to water ingress and fire risk. With a 'Below Average' reliability verdict and 315 Technical Service Bulletins, owners should prioritize regular inspections of the liftgate and its wiring, alongside verifying critical software updates for airbags and cruise control.

Key Takeaways

  • Proactive inspection of the power liftgate module and wiring is crucial due to fire risk.
  • Confirm completion of recalls related to airbags and cruise control systems.
